Quote:
Originally Posted by pierre smith
RV-10. The airplane was built in Montana and has 208TT and an Aerosport-IO-540, Dynon 100/120, 496, SL-30 and a Garmin 340. Trutrak ADI Pilot II, Flightline leather interior and the panel by Aerotronics. Superb workmanship on a modified Lancair panel:
It consistently trues over 200 MPH at altitude with two up.

Greg Connell's -10
Although she's officially named 'Miss Ginger', after his beautiful wife, he mostly refers to the -10 as Bo Derek and has her shown as the tail art, which I'll add later. Here are two nice shots:
Dual Cheltons, a 430W, Sorcerer autopilot, PS Engineering audio panel, etc.
He has a 300 HP 'warmed up' IO-540 and Sam James cowl and plenum.
Actually, it's nose art:
